Output e2b0c1d6d14ef99efa862deae8b4c19f00aca83a2a2ce8a3f91668190a2135b9:17

value
3024019
script pubkey
OP_0 OP_PUSHBYTES_20 04b5d53e2132258ad4cd00335eafee3f8412235f
address
bc1qqj6a203pxgjc44xdqqe4atlw87zpyg6lsl6xac
transaction
e2b0c1d6d14ef99efa862deae8b4c19f00aca83a2a2ce8a3f91668190a2135b9
confirmations
325890
spent
true